Output dcb246d138628272098f35ff93559db75dfc7e534dc5a9042c895742659d1528:5

value
168019708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4d5ffbe418e1a8360ab37a90be03e963373a5b OP_EQUAL
address
34TEtQMpyN51GcET2jaqB3UbrYmUufh229
transaction
dcb246d138628272098f35ff93559db75dfc7e534dc5a9042c895742659d1528
spent
true